According to this existing answer, LTool is not public, but used internally at JPL. However, the public description of the LTool package does list contact email addresses; so it may be possible to email and request a copy of the tool.

2LTool was developed by the folks in Section 343 at JPL (reorganization might have changed that number since I left JPL) who jealously guard their software. They might give you information about how they approach the mechanics, but I seriously doubt they would export it. Unless...they now have something better, so it's probably worth a try. – Tom Spilker Jul 19 '18 at 16:30

1It's not so much about closely guarding. The main reason that they don't like to distribute their software is that they don't want to have to make it presentable, don't want to have to make it useable, don't want to have to document it, and don't want to have to answer questions about it from outside users. – Mark Adler Jul 19 '18 at 20:23
-
1Technically, since the development was done with government funds, NASA can request outside distribution of any software and JPL could not refuse on the basis of competitive advantage. However then JPL would counter with a requirement for funds from NASA for the cleanup, documentation, and support. That would probably be the end of the discussion right there. – Mark Adler Jul 19 '18 at 20:23
